In order to realize the non-contact measurement of three dimensional deformation of the tested object
the three dimensional deformation measurement system based on electronic speckle pattern interferometry(ESPI) is designed. In this designed system
the one-to-five type fiber is one part to dispart and propagate light.
which making the designed measurement system sample. Combining ESPI and the phase-shifting technique to get the quantitative deformation measurement. And PZT is used to shift the phase
the deformation results are calculated by “4+1” phase-shifting algorithm. The designed system can realize the in-plane and out-plane deformation measurement respectively
further
three dimensional deformation measurement of the tested object can be gotten. The experimental results of the in-plane
out-plane and three dimensional deformation for the wood block with defect and the steel plate with stress validate the designed system.
